Presentation Transcript


  1. Automated Deployment Framework Using TFS and Custom PowerShell cmdlets to create an automated deployment framework

  2. Agenda • TFS Build/Deploy • Extending TFS Build/Deploy • Custom PowerShell Cmdlets • Putting it all Together

  3. TFS Build/Deploy • How it works • Workflow Activities • XAML • Build Definitions • Build Controllers/Agents

  4. TFS Build/Deploy • Default Process • Trigger • Local Workspace/Drop Folder • Build • Test • MSBuild

  5. TFS Build/Deploy • Restrictions • Build Packages • Deploy only through the msbuildcommand • Rebuilds projects/solution every time

  6. Extending TFS Build/Deploy • The Templates • XAML (Silverlight was actually worth something!) • Workflow Activities • Custom Activities and Editors • Build Controller Assemblies • Start with the default template and add/remove as needed • Test Frequently!

  7. Extending TFS Build/Deploy • PowerShell • Object based • Snapins/modules for about every MS product • Remote server commands getting rolled into many cmdlets • Excellent community support

  8. Extending TFS Build/Deploy • PowerShell The EEEvil Stuff • Getting rolled into products by separate product teams • Error Handling • Escaping • rEtrieve Behavior

  9. Extending TFS Build/Deploy • WebDeploy • Package deployment • SetParameter Files • Remote Execution of Scripts • Azure and Lab Deployments

  10. Extending TFS Build/Deploy • Setting it up • Update the template to run a PowerShell script (copy scripts locally and execute it) • Setup a PowerShell script to do your deployment by executing a WebDeploycommand line • Setup your build definitions

  11. Extending TFS Build/Deploy • Drawbacks to the straight PowerShell approach • Whomever creates/maintains the deployments must know the ins and outs of PowerShell and each PowerShell module you use (iis, adfs, SQL, server, etc) • With multiple deployments, you end up with a lot of duplication between scripts • Complex deployments result in complex scripts

  12. Custom PowerShell Cmdlets • Expose .NET code through PowerShell • System.Management.Automation • Inherit from Cmdlet and override BeginProcessing and ProcessRecord methods • Provide help/examples through an xml file • Create a cmdlet for each type of deployment you support and for any common deployment tasks • Can pass in parameters, a file path, use a database, etc for deployment info depending on the complexity of the deployment

  13. Custom PowerShell Cmdlets • Install the custom cmdletson each TFSbuild agent (using PowerShell of course) • Update the PowerShell deployment scripts to call your custom cmdlets
